>I was wrong, james.. You'll have to forgive me, I'm pretty new at this. What
>I didn't remember about 2nf is that concatenated keys only cause trouble
>when a non-key attribute is functionally determined by one of the keys and
>not the key combination, so you were ok from the get-go. - my stupid
>mistake.
>
>Correct me if I'm wrong guys - I know you will - but if there were an
>attribute in the table such as StreetAddress (that would belong in the
>buildings table) that was dependant on only the BuildingID, that would cause
>a violation, right?
